Situated within the popular residential area of Summerhill, this well-presented three bedroom semi-detached home offers spacious and versatile accommodation, ideal for modern family living. In brief, the accommodation comprises an entrance hallway, cosy living room with feature log burner, a spacious open plan kitchen/dining area and a conservatory to the rear, creating excellent ground floor living and entertaining space. To the first floor, the landing provides access to three bedrooms and a family bathroom. Externally, the property benefits from a driveway providing off-road parking, a detached garage and a thoughtfully landscaped multi-level rear garden enjoying far-reaching views across Wrexham. Beech Street is a sought-after residential location within Summerhill, offering a range of local amenities within walking distance including shops, schools and everyday conveniences. The scenic Moss Valley Country Park is nearby, providing beautiful countryside walks, cycling routes and leisure opportunities, while Wrexham city centre is just a short drive away offering a wider selection of retail, dining and leisure facilities. Excellent transport links are also available via the nearby A483, providing convenient access to Chester, Oswestry and the wider North West.
